Problem 10-3 Average Cost (LO2)
In a slow year, Deutsche Burgers will produce 3 million hamburgers at a total cost of $3.9 million. In a good year, it can produce 6 million hamburgers at a total cost of $5.4 million.
What is the average cost per burger when the firm produces 1.5 million hamburgers? (Do not round intermediate calculations. Round your answer to 2 decimal places.)
What is average cost when the firm produces 3 million hamburgers? (Round your answer to 2 decimal places.)

Explanation / Answer
Let fixed cost be x and variable be y
x + 3000000y = 3900000
x + 6000000y = 5400000
3000000y = 1500000
y = 0.5
x = 2.4 million
Hence fixed cost is 2.4 million and variale cost is $0.5
a)
for producing 1.5million burgers cost is 2.4m + 1.5 * 0.5 = 3.15m
average cost is 3.15 / 1.5 = $2.1 per buger
b) for 3 million burgers average cost is 3.9 / 3 = $1.3 per burger
c) The fixed costs are spread across more burgers
